Autometer bezel doesn't fit Excursions

I had DI order this Autometer gauge mount for me along with my new tranny temp and air pressure gauges. Well I went to pick it all up today and I decided to test fit the bezel before I bought it and I'm glad I did! It was a little too wide and the molded corners were totally the wrong shape to fit the Ex dash. [img]/ubbthreads/images/graemlins/mad.gif[/img] I didn't even know the Ex dash was a different shape than the trucks, but they tell me it is. Even if it did fit with some trimming (although I think no amount of trimming would have worked), I don't think the gauges would have fit without hitting the stock instrument panel.

SO...what to do now? I have four gauges. Two already exist in my two pod pillar mount. I can't go overhead because I really don't want to try and run the air lines up there. My brake controller is already under the cubby hole so that spot is out (although I'm considering moving it). Plus I don't like having to look down so far to see a gauge. Anyone have any ideas?
